What is a Freelance Proposal Writer job?

A Freelance Proposal Writer creates compelling proposals to help businesses, nonprofits, or individuals secure contracts, grants, or new clients. They research requirements, draft persuasive content, and tailor proposals to meet the needs of potential funders or partners. This role often involves working independently on a project basis, collaborating with clients to develop winning proposals. Strong writing, research, and communication skills are essential for success in this field.

What are some common challenges faced by freelance proposal writers, and how can they be managed?

Freelance proposal writers often face challenges such as tight deadlines, coordinating with remote clients, and quickly understanding diverse industries or project requirements. Successfully managing these challenges involves establishing clear communication with clients, maintaining an organized workflow, and quickly adapting your writing style to meet varying expectations. Utilizing project management tools and setting realistic timelines can help balance multiple assignments and avoid burnout. Staying updated with industry trends and continuously expanding your writing portfolio can also make you more competitive in the freelance marketplace. Overall, proactive planning and effective client communication are key to successfully navigating the freelance workflow.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Freelance Proposal Writer position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Freelance Proposal Writer, you need excellent research, writing, and editing skills, a strong grasp of persuasive communication, and often a bachelor's degree in English, communications, or a related field. Familiarity with proposal management tools (such as RFPIO or Qvidian), Microsoft Office Suite, and sometimes certifications like the APMP (Association of Proposal Management Professionals) can be advantageous. Outstanding organization, adaptability, and client communication skills help you manage multiple projects and deliver client-focused content on tight deadlines. These abilities ensure you can craft compelling, compliant proposals that increase clients' chances of winning new business.

Proposal Writing Consultant (Freelance / Remote)
Location: Remote | Type: Project-Based / As-Needed

BETAH Associates, Inc., a leading professional services firm, is seeking a skilled and agile Proposal Writing Consultant to augment our proposal development capacity and support a growing pipeline of federal government opportunities. This freelance, remote role offers flexibility while engaging in meaningful, deadline-driven work that drives real impact.

We are looking for an experienced proposal writer who excels in high-volume, fast-paced environments. You must be a clear, persuasive communicator and a collaborative team player who welcomes constructive feedback and consistently delivers high-quality work under pressure.

This role spans the full proposal lifecycle?from analyzing solicitations and shaping strategy and approach to writing, editing, and finalizing content. Proposal efforts will primarily focus on BETAH?s core capabilities: communications, peer review support, event and conference management, and other professional services.

Workload will fluctuate based on the volume of active opportunities and often requires meeting tight deadlines with quick turnarounds.

Ideal candidates will bring:

  • A proven track record of crafting compliant, compelling content for federal proposals tailored to meet requirements? scope, evaluation criteria, and goals.
  • The ability to quickly understand agency missions and translate technical requirements into strong narratives
  • Familiarity with federal agencies such as The Department of Health and Human Services (HHS), The Department of Justice (DOJ), or U.S. Department of the Treasury is a strong plus.
 

Key Responsibilities

  • Analyze RFIs, RFQs, RFPs, SOWs, and evaluation criteria to shape content strategy
  • Participate in kickoff and strategy sessions to align win themes and assignments
  • Collaborate with proposal managers and SMEs to gather input and clarify concepts
  • Develop original, tailored content for technical, management, staffing, and past performance sections
  • Ensure a cohesive and consistent voice across content developed by multiple writers and subject matter experts, harmonizing tone, style, and messaging to produce a unified and compelling final narrative.
  • Customize boilerplate material to align with requirements scope, tone, and structure
  • Revise content in response to reviewer feedback, ensuring compliance and clarity
  • Edit and proofread for accuracy, consistency, and flow
  • Manage version control and deliver work on time
  • Assist with submission logistics when needed
 

Qualifications

  • 7+ years of hands-on experience writing federal government proposals
  • Demonstrated success in producing compliant, persuasive content under pressure
  • Strong writing, editing, and critical thinking skills
  • Deep understanding of federal procurement processes and language
  • Ability to synthesize input into clear, concise narratives
  • Collaborative spirit and comfort working in a virtual team environment
  • Proficiency in the Office 365 Platform, Teams, SharePoint, Microsoft Word and Adobe Acrobat
  • Knowledge of structured proposal processes and review cycles (e.g., Shipley Method or equivalent)
  • Prior experience in proposal coordination, management, and capture planning preferred
